摘要
考察了分区广义变分原理在构造板壳有限元中的应用、由于放松了单元交界上的连续性要求,用分区广义变分原理构造的板壳单元,不仅具有自由度少,计算工作量小的优点,而且有效地改善了单元的收敛性能,提高了有限元解的精度。算例表明,分区广义变分原理在板壳有限元中有良好的应用前景。
This paper is confined to the study of FEM. in plates and shells based on piecewised generalized variational principle. According to this principle, the continuity requirement between interelement is relaxed, and the modified elements based on this principle have the advantages of less degree of freedom, good property of convergence and enough accuracy for practical application. Several typical examples are presented. The results indicate the effectiveness of the modified finite elements.
